Booking.com高效搜索需规范输入目的地与时间、启用高级筛选、使用英文标签、调整排序方式、匹配语言地区设置。

如果您希望在Booking.com上快速定位符合需求的住宿,但搜索结果不精准或筛选条件未生效,则可能是关键词输入不规范或筛选设置未正确启用。以下是完成高效酒店搜索的具体操作步骤:
一、输入准确的目的地与时间关键词
Booking.com的搜索结果高度依赖初始关键词的明确性。模糊的城市简称、错别字或未指定行政层级(如省/州)会导致系统匹配到无关区域,从而遗漏目标酒店。
1、在Booking.com首页或App主界面顶部的搜索框中,输入完整且官方认可的地名,例如“Badger, Wisconsin, United States”而非仅“Badger”。
2、点击日期栏,手动选择入住与离店日期,避免使用默认日期或“随时入住”等非限定选项。
3、点击人数栏,明确选择成人与儿童数量及年龄,部分酒店对儿童政策敏感,未填写可能导致房型不可见。
二、启用并优化高级筛选条件
筛选功能需主动开启并逐项配置,系统不会自动应用全部可用选项。未勾选关键标签(如“免费取消”“含早餐”)将导致符合条件的酒店被排除在结果之外。
1、在搜索结果页面右侧或底部,点击“筛选条件”按钮(网页端为侧边栏,App端为折叠菜单)。
2、在“价格”区域,拖动滑块设定预算上限,而非仅依赖默认排序。
3、在“星级”区域,勾选3星或4星对应复选框(如“Badger 3星级酒店”“Brogo 4星级酒店”),注意区分“仅显示该星级”与“包含及以上”选项。
4、在“设施与服务”区域,勾选“免费取消”“含早餐”“停车服务”等实际需要的选项,避免多选无关项导致结果过少。
三、利用关键词标签提升匹配精度
Booking.com支持在搜索框中直接嵌入结构化关键词标签,这些标签可绕过常规语义解析,直连后台房源属性字段,显著提高特定类型酒店的召回率。
1、在搜索框中输入目的地后,在同一行末尾添加英文冒号+标签名,例如:“Badger :free_cancellation”或“Brogo :breakfast_included”。
2、多个标签可用空格分隔,如:“Badger :3_star :pet_friendly”。标签名必须与Booking后台字段完全一致,不支持中文或自定义词。
3、常见有效标签包括:free_cancellation、breakfast_included、parking、wifi、pool、pet_friendly、family_rooms、non_smoking_rooms。
四、调整排序方式以强化关键词权重
默认排序按“推荐度”计算,可能弱化关键词匹配结果;切换至“距离”或“评分”排序时,系统会重新加权关键词相关性,使标签匹配更靠前。
1、在搜索结果页顶部,找到“排序方式”下拉菜单(通常位于结果数量旁)。
2、依次尝试选择“距离最近”“评分最高”“价格最低”三种模式,观察目标酒店是否出现在前两页。
3、若某家酒店(如艾霍斯特全球表达套房酒店)在“评分最高”排序下突然出现,说明其用户评价中高频出现的关键词(如“Petronas Twin Towers”“阳光广场”)已被系统识别并关联。
五、检查语言与地区设置对关键词的影响
Booking.com会根据用户当前语言和所在地区自动适配关键词映射逻辑。同一中文词在不同区域版本中可能指向不同地理编码,导致搜索失效。
1、点击页面右上角头像或“语言/货币”图标,确认当前语言为English(US)或目标国家官方语言,避免使用“简体中文(中国)”搜索海外酒店。
2、在语言设置中,同步检查并手动设置正确货币单位(如USD、EUR),防止因价格换算偏差触发错误过滤。
3、若搜索“Badger 3星级酒店”无结果,可尝试切换至“English (United Kingdom)”并输入“Badger hotel 3 star”,验证是否因地域词库差异导致匹配失败。











